Problems solved by technology

As a kind of salad oil, the refined camellia oil has good appearance and transparency when the temperature is high, but when the temperature is close to 0°C in winter, flocculent floating matter (according to the test is solid fat) may appear, thus Seriously affect the quality of the product
Studies have found that injections made of oils containing impurities can trigger pyrogenic reactions in the body, seriously threatening the lives of patients

Abstract

The invention relates to a preparation method and application of medical tea oil. The preparation method comprises the following steps: (1) performing refined extraction; (2) deacidifying, namely, agitating and heating tea essential oil, dissolving KOH with soft water to obtain an alkaline solution after the oil temperature raises to 70-75 DEG C, rapidly and uniformly spraying into soil, fully mixing, stopping agitating after nigre particles appear, heating to 80 DEG C, standing at the constant temperature for 12 hours to completely precipitate, transferring upper clear oil to a washing pot, heating the oil to 85 DEG C, adding hot water to wash, standing at the constant temperature for 1 hour, separating out the upper clear oil, and then dewatering and drying under a vacuum condition to obtain the deacidified oil; (3) discoloring; (4) deodorizing; and (5) fractionating. Compared with the prior art, the method focuses on the selection of technological conditions; the tea oil is heated to be 70 to 75 DEG C during deacidifying, then the alkaline solution is added, and the tea oil is precipitated at the constant temperature of 80 DEG C. The medical tea oil prepared under the technological conditions has the advantages that the fractionating is carried out at 19 to 21 DEG C, and the low-temperature winterization can be saved.

Description

technical field [0001] The invention belongs to the technical field of preparation of pharmaceutical excipients, and in particular relates to a preparation method and application of medical camellia oil. Background technique [0002] Camellia oil is edible oil extracted from wild camellia seeds, also known as camellia oil and camellia oil. The unsaturated fatty acid content of camellia oil is more than 85%, the content of vitamin A and E is high, and it is storage-resistant and easy to be absorbed by the human body. Camellia oil does not contain erucic acid which is harmful to the human body, and it can also prevent and treat high blood pressure and cardiovascular diseases. It is the best among edible vegetable oils. In industry, tea oil can be used to produce oleic acid and its esters, to produce soap and vaseline, etc., and also to produce stearic acid and glycerin.
